The short version

Pawnee County has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$62,188. Population has fallen 18% since 2000, a loss of 557 residents. 21%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 36%.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$79,400. With a median age of 44.9, the population is older than the US median of 38.9.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Pawnee County, Nebraska?

Pawnee County, Nebraska has about 2,530 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Pawnee County, Nebraska?

The typical household in Pawnee County, Nebraska earns about $62,188 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Pawnee County, Nebraska expensive?

In Pawnee County, Nebraska, the median home is worth about $79,400, and the typical rent is about $706 a month.

How educated are people in Pawnee County, Nebraska?

About 21.2% of adults age 25 and over in Pawnee County, Nebraska h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Pawnee County, Nebraska?

About 13.5% of people in Pawnee County, Nebraska live below the federal poverty line.
